Dash In C-Stores Owner Wills Group Opens New HQ In Maryland

Dash In convenience stores owner The Wills Group has opened a new headquarters in La Plata, Maryland. Buc-ee’s Opening Royse City, Texas, Store On June 17

Six a.m. is opening time for the new Buc-ee’s store in Royse City, Texas. That’s on Monday morning, June 17. The “legendary roadside refuge for travelers” will offer its Texas Round Up barbeque, beef jerky, homemade fudge and Beaver Nuggets (caramel-coated corn pops), among other items Buc-ee’s is known for. 7-Eleven Showcases ‘Breakout Brands’ In Los Angeles-Area Stores

7-Eleven is launching a new wave of food and beverages in 125 Los Angeles-area stores from an exclusive list of breakout brands. Nearly 100 new better-for-you items were hand-selected for the test by 7-Eleven from 31 up-and-coming companies. GasBuddy Study: C-Stores ‘Eating’ Into Quick Service Restaurants

A new study from GasBuddy reveals gas station convenience stores are taking the market share from quick service restaurants. The study also concludes 43 percent of Millennials purchase more food from c-stores now than three years ago. Fast food restaurants have been the go-to for a quick bite for decades.
